Output 4afedf917e99075d5d46b918afde93d16e174f539108293e049abcb3321473ee:63

value
1686680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e60d181b3fdb596f5f5e4421c3dcfc80522324 OP_EQUAL
address
MTVSRiUjnpUB22yb13jF5RyphcYEWJ66ED
transaction
4afedf917e99075d5d46b918afde93d16e174f539108293e049abcb3321473ee
spent
true